French door repair

French doors are a beautiful addition to any home. They can be damaged by extreme weather conditions, or wear and tear. Fortunately, there are many ways to fix or restore these doors to their original splendor. A reputable repair company for doors can help with any issues you might face.

A damaged latch or lock is a typical issue with French Doors. These are essential for security and should be repaired as soon as is possible. If they are not addressed the issues could lead to expensive and inconvenient repairs. A professional door repair expert can assist you in finding a solution that is right for your home and can restore your French Doors to their former glory.

Leakage around the frame is another common issue with French Doors. This can cause damp and rot throughout your house. It could also be risky. Professional door repair services can solve this issue by repairing or reinstalling the damaged seals and weatherstripping.

The weatherstripping on French doors is crucial for keeping out drafts and increasing energy efficiency. It is susceptible to wear over time as a result of usage and age. A door repair expert will replace the weatherstripping of your French doors to restore their insulation and avoid draughts.

French doors often suffer from many small issues that include misalignment, or hinges that are warped. These problems are easy to fix, but in the event that they are serious, it is best to consult an expert.

A door that isn't closing properly can be frustrating, especially in the case of children or pets in the home. It could also be dangerous, especially if you have to leave the house in bad weather. You should try to close the doors as much as possible in order to pinpoint the issue. It could be because the jambs on the doors aren't close enough or the doors don't clean one another up properly.

UPVC window replacement

UPVC (Unplasticized Polyvinyl Chloride) is a popular material for window frames and sills. It offers a durable alternative to hardwood timber or aluminium and is also less expensive. It is also easy to install and maintain. This makes it an ideal choice for new constructions or replacement of old windows. It is also a great choice for guttering, drainpipes and other similar uses. It resists corrosion caused by chemicals, rain, salt erosiveness and other factors.

It is also recyclable and nontoxic, making it a great choice for your home. UPVC is free of lead and BPA and is also resistant to a wide range of chemicals. It has a low melting point and is able to be cut into various shapes. Its features make it a good choice for many applications including double glazing near me-glazed doors, windows and sills.

uPVC windows are an excellent choice for those who are on a tight budget. They provide many advantages that wood cottage windows don't. These include energy efficiency, improved security, and a decrease in noise pollution. In contrast to traditional windows that decay and rust, uPVC does not require costly maintenance.
